Struct vega_lite::DateTime

source ·
pub struct DateTime {
    pub date: Option<f64>,
    pub day: Option<Day>,
    pub hours: Option<f64>,
    pub milliseconds: Option<f64>,
    pub minutes: Option<f64>,
    pub month: Option<Month>,
    pub quarter: Option<f64>,
    pub seconds: Option<f64>,
    pub utc: Option<bool>,
    pub year: Option<f64>,
}
Expand description

Object for defining datetime in Vega-Lite Filter. If both month and quarter are provided, month has higher precedence. day cannot be combined with other date. We accept string for month and day names.

Fields§

§date: Option<f64>

Integer value representing the date from 1-31.

§day: Option<Day>

Value representing the day of a week. This can be one of: (1) integer value – 1 represents Monday; (2) case-insensitive day name (e.g., "Monday"); (3) case-insensitive, 3-character short day name (e.g., "Mon").
Warning: A DateTime definition object with day** should not be combined with year, quarter, month, or date.

§hours: Option<f64>

Integer value representing the hour of a day from 0-23.

§milliseconds: Option<f64>

Integer value representing the millisecond segment of time.

§minutes: Option<f64>

Integer value representing the minute segment of time from 0-59.

§month: Option<Month>

One of: (1) integer value representing the month from 1-12. 1 represents January; (2) case-insensitive month name (e.g., "January"); (3) case-insensitive, 3-character short month name (e.g., "Jan").

§quarter: Option<f64>

Integer value representing the quarter of the year (from 1-4).

§seconds: Option<f64>

Integer value representing the second segment (0-59) of a time value

§utc: Option<bool>

A boolean flag indicating if date time is in utc time. If false, the date time is in local time

§year: Option<f64>

Integer value representing the year.
